C Callahan Agency
- Address
- 1660 Tower St
- Place
- Schenectady , NY 12303
Description
C Callahan Agency can be found at 1660 Tower St . The following is offered: Car Insurance - In Schenectady there are 10 other Car Insurance. An overview can be found here.
Reviews
This listing was not reviewed yet